witam,
czy ktoś wie która to funkcja w kodzie wskaźnika jest odpowiedzialna za wyświetlanie wskazanych strzałką wartości?
chcę aby te wartości wyświetlane były jako tło, czyli żeby to wykres je przykrywał, a nie na odwrót, jak ma to miejsce na załączonym screenie.
dziękuję, pozdrawiam
wyświetlanie wartości wskaźnika
wyświetlanie wartości wskaźnika
Nie masz wymaganych uprawnień, aby zobaczyć pliki załączone do tego posta.
nie potrzebuję, można by je schować na dobre, tak jak zaproponowałeś. wówczas taka wersja odpowiadała by mi najbardziej.bakubaq pisze:Tak to się raczej nie da, co najwyżej można je schować , albo wyciągnąć do głównego okna jeśli ich potrzebujesz.amerro pisze:chcę aby te wartości wyświetlane były jako tło,
poprosiłbym Cię o wklejenie tutaj kodu, który spowoduje ukrycie tychże wartości, pozostawiając jedynie nazwę wskaźnika, albowiem chciałbym również zastosować go w jeszcze innym wskaźniku.
dziękuję, pozdrawiam
- Pierz Andrzej
- Przyjaciel Forum
- Posty: 1200
- Rejestracja: 02 lip 2006, 14:17
Kod: Zaznacz cały
IndicatorShortName("");
SetIndexLabel(0,NULL);
SetIndexLabel(1,NULL);
Andrzej PIerz
z poważaniem
Andrzej Pierz
FOREX-SERVICE
Andrzej Pierz
FOREX-SERVICE
tak też zrobił bakubaq. jednak to nie powoduje ukrycia wartości wskaźnika, a jedynie ich przeniesienie do głównego okna wykresu, jak na załączonym screenie.Pierz Andrzej pisze:pozdrawiamKod: Zaznacz cały
IndicatorShortName(""); SetIndexLabel(0,NULL); SetIndexLabel(1,NULL);
Andrzej PIerz
sprawa komplikuje się trochę bardziej przy drugim wskaźniku, gdzie prawdopodobnie kod odpowiedzialny za wyświetlanie tych wartości wygląda następująco:
TimeFrame = stringToTimeFrame(timeFrame);
string shortName = " RSI (Chart "+TimeFrameToString(TimeFrame)
+", RSI Period "+RSIPeriod;
if (overBought < overSold) overBought = overSold;
if (overBought < 100) shortName = shortName+", "+overBought;
if (overSold > 0) shortName = shortName+", "+overSold;
IndicatorShortName(shortName+") ");
a zatem jak w obydwu przypadkach schować to na dobre, a nie przenosić na wykres główny?
pozdrawiam
Nie masz wymaganych uprawnień, aby zobaczyć pliki załączone do tego posta.
Tak jak Andrzej napisał jest dobrze, za przenoszenie odpowiada parę dodatkowych linijek na końcu. Tu masz czysty-sama nazwa.amerro pisze:tak też zrobił bakubaq. jednak to nie powoduje ukrycia wartości wskaźnika, a jedynie ich przeniesienie do głównego okna wykresu,
To chyba mtf rsi ob/os, w załączniku z samą nazwą.amerro pisze:TimeFrame = stringToTimeFrame(timeFrame);
string shortName = " RSI (Chart "+TimeFrameToString(TimeFrame)
+", RSI Period "+RSIPeriod;
if (overBought < overSold) overBought = overSold;
if (overBought < 100) shortName = shortName+", "+overBought;
if (overSold > 0) shortName = shortName+", "+overSold;
IndicatorShortName(shortName+") ");
Nie masz wymaganych uprawnień, aby zobaczyć pliki załączone do tego posta.
zgadza się. nie zauważyłem, że na końcu coś tam jeszcze dokleiłeś, aby poza usunięciem ich z okna wskaźnika, przeniosło wartości na główny wykres.bakubaq pisze:Tak jak Andrzej napisał jest dobrze, za przenoszenie odpowiada parę dodatkowych linijek na końcu. Tu masz czysty-sama nazwa.
serdeczne dzięki Panowie. wnoszę o pochwałę dla obydwu skłonnych do bezinteresownej pomocy użytkowników.
wszystkiego dobrego, dzięki i pozdrawiam